Add license scanning badge

In CNCF, we are starting to experiment with automated license scanning across our projects to ensure compliance to the CNCF IP Policy. For now, we're experimenting with FOSSA: https://app.fossa.io/reports/50dc07d0-435f-4856-9549-33a5f41bef81

containerd is an industry-standard container runtime with an emphasis on simplicity, robustness and portability. It is available as a daemon for Linux and Windows, which can manage the complete container lifecycle of its host system: image transfer and storage, container execution and supervision, low-level storage and network attachments, etc.. containerd is an industry-standard container runtime with an emphasis on simplicity, robustness and portability.
